The Content & PR Manager Role:

- Lead, define and execute the content strategy and calendar globally, working with Product Managers, Engineering, and external contributors (freelancers and agencies) to create high-quality content optimized for SEO and conversions.
- Drive the development of brand voice as well their position of influence in the technology space worldwide.
- Be the voice of the business in social media by crafting great social media posts that drive traffic, generate engagement, and build community with relevant stakeholders such as compliance professionals, developers, and engineers.
- Own the publication and distribution process. You will share content in the appropriate communities, pitch it to newsletters and publications, and get other companies and blogs to link to it.
- Analyze key content marketing metrics and suggest improvements to increase engagement and conversions
- Develop copy and visual assets (infographics, videos) for a range of channels and campaigns, including reports, articles, social media, PR, etc.

Ideal Skills/Experience for the Content & PR Manager:

- You have at least 4 years’ demonstrable experience in a content marketing and/or PR role in an Enterprise/B2B tech environment.
- A graduate degree, preferably in Journalism, English, Marketing, or a related field
- You have a passion for creating content that tell a story and engages your audience. A particular interest in technology and how it can be applied to solve complex business problems is highly desired.
- You have demonstrable experience of writing, editing and distributing effective copy for a variety of sales and marketing purposes and channels.
- Strong SEO understanding and skills
- You have a track record of establishing and nurturing relationships with key external stakeholders and contacts in press and media.
